Getting out on Casco Bay

Casco Bay Ferry Lines is just down the hill (Less than a mile walk or drive) from Vesper Street and an easy and affordable way to explore the islands of Casco Bay. I highly recommend heading out to Peaks Island or Great Diamond Island for Dinner. Check the ferry schedule here https://www.cascobaylines.com/schedules/. The outside deck at the Cockeyed Gull is a favorite of ours (call for a reservation a day or two in advance). Also worth checking out Diamonds Edge on Great Diamond. There are also mailboat runs and other specialty cruises https://www.cascobaylines.com/maine-boat-tours/specialty-cruises/.

This is a favorite. Near Bath and Reid State Park. It's on a wharf in the picturesque town of Five Islands. If you don't get lobster, the Jenny is worth a try (crabcake plus haddock sandwich). While there you might want to look for the little nature trail off Ledgemere Road. It will take you out to the rocky coastline.

Quintessential Maine beach. Try to hit low tide so you can walk out to the islands. If you need a lobster roll, beer or sandwich to take with you to the beach, the Bisson Center Store in Phippsburg is an option. You'll pass it on the way. Beware of the Popham seagulls. They aggressively want your sandwich!
